Barkheda Loya Population - Mandsaur, Madhya Pradesh

Barkheda Loya is a large village located in Garoth Tehsil of Mandsaur district, Madhya Pradesh with total 577 families residing. The Barkheda Loya village has population of 2319 of which 1161 are males while 1158 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Barkheda Loya village population of children with age 0-6 is 241 which makes up 10.39 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Barkheda Loya village is 997 which is higher than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Barkheda Loya as per census is 883, lower than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.

Barkheda Loya village has higher liter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Barkheda Loya village was 74.30 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Barkheda Loya Male literacy stands at 91.38 % while female literacy rate was 57.42 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 20.35 % while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0.39 % of total population in Barkheda Loya village.

Work Profile

In Barkheda Loya village out of total population, 1470 were engaged in work activities. 97.76 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 2.24 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 1470 workers engaged in Main Work, 838 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 514 were Agricultural labourer.
